Another Israel-bound shipment seized at Tanjung Pelepas port

Malaysia's authorities once again intercepted a cargo container destined for Israel at the Tanjung Pelepas port, according to Bloomberg. The incident followed the seizure of a container from the Philippines on August 7, which was intercepted by the Malaysia Maritime Enforcement Agency (AMSEA) due to suspicions of weapons intended for the Israeli defense technology firm, Elbit Systems Ltd. The containers, carrying electric bike spare parts from a Chinese manufacturer, were intercepted on August 19 and are currently under investigation.

The seizure comes in the wake of a similar action taken against a container from the Philippines on August 7, which was also suspected of containing weapons for the Israeli defense technology firm Elbit Systems Ltd. AMSEA stated that the items were examined to confirm the type, specifications, purpose, and classification, as well as to determine if they were subject to export control regulations.

Malaysia does not have diplomatic relations with Israel, and the Strategic Trade Act of 2010 also controls the export of sensitive technology and materials to combat terrorism, nuclear proliferation, and the proliferation of weapons of mass destruction.
